+Please email the following information to assign@gnu.org, and we will
+send you the disclaimer form for your changes.  This form is preferred
+when your changes are small, they do not add any nontrivial new
+files, and you are finished making them (aside perhaps from small bug
+fixes).
+
+If you would like to make further contributions to the same package,
+and you would like to avoid the need to sign more papers when you
+contribute them, you have another option: to sign a copyright
+assignment covering your future changes.  If that is what you want to
+do, please tell the maintainer you would prefer to sign an assignment
+of past and future changes.
